What are the responsibilities and job description for the Systems Specialist position at Giesecke+Devrient?
Summary
Responsible for building and testing systems, sub-assemblies or prototypes of new products. Duties require a high degree of accuracy in fitting and adjusting material to meet exacting specifications, perform operations required to position, attach, solder and assemble components in the location and sequence shown on drawings. Conduct tests on complete units following prescribed procedures. Ensure manufacturing and quality processes are delivered and conform to company quality standards. Provide engineering support for the planning and implementation of specialized manufacturing projects.
Duties / Responsibilities

- Perform alignment (setup) procedures per quality assurance specifications.
- Recommend and / or design test equipment to increase accuracy and throughput of production material.
- Use work instructions, assembly documents and bills of material to aid in assembly and repair of machines.
- Test and ensure all production line machines are operating prior to transportation to quality assurance.
- Instruct others in use of tools, fixture and assembly procedures.
- Provide technical and administrative support to other manufacturing assembler personnel.
- Participate in manufacturing design review meetings.
- Review new and revised designs for manufacturing feasibility.
- Recommend improvements that increase product uniformity and reliability, thus reducing field failures and complaints.
- Set up work centers for assembly including work instructions, tools, fixtures and orderly arrangement of raw materials.
